京都 Common Lisp

京都 Common Lisp
原作者湯浅大一、萩谷昌美
開発者SIGLISP(京都大学数理解析研究所
初回リリース1984年4月 (1984-04
安定版リリース
「1987年6月3日」 / 1987年6月3日 (1987年6月3日
書かれたCCommon Lisp
オペレーティング·システムUnix、VMS、AOS
ライセンスSIGLISPライセンス[ 1 ]

Kyoto Common Lisp ( KCL ) は、湯浅太一萩谷正美によって書かれたCommon Lispの実装であり、Unix系オペレーティングシステム上で動作するようにC言語で記述されています。KCLはANSI Cにコンパイルされています。Guy Steeleの著書『Common Lisp the Language』の1984年初版に記載されているCommon Lispに準拠しており、ライセンス契約に基づいて利用可能です。[ 2 ]

KCLは、標準化委員会の外で、仕様のみに基づいてゼロから実装されました。これはCommon Lispの実装としては最初のものの一つであり、これまで気づかれていなかった仕様上の多くの欠陥や誤りを露呈しました。

派生ソフトウェア

参考文献

  1. ^ 「Kyoto Common Lisp のライセンス契約」 。 2018年7月12日時点のオリジナルよりアーカイブ2020年10月28日閲覧。
  2. ^この記事は、2008 年 11 月 1 日より前にFree On-line Dictionary of Computing のKyoto+Common+Lispから取得した資料に基づいており、 GFDLバージョン 1.3 以降 の「再ライセンス」条項に基づいて組み込まれています。
  3. ^ 「GCL - GNU Common Lisp」
  4. ^ 「埋め込み可能なCommon-Lisp」
  5. ^ 「MKCL」
  6. ^ 「Ibuki CL、KCLの商用バージョン」